Check slot status before accessing the PWS
The Nitrokey devices do not check whether a PWS slot is programmed before accessing it (upstream issues [0] [1]). Until this is fixed in the firmware, we have to manually check the slot status in pws get. This could have been done in libnitrokey or the nitrokey crate, yet this would lead to unnecessary commands if we check multiple fields of a slot at the same time.
